método de desmodulizar

No ruby ​​on rails, você pode remover a parte do módulo de uma expressão constante com o método ‘.demodulize’, por exemplo:

'FooNamespace::FooBar'.demodulize
> 'FooBar'

Você também pode usar esse método no ruby, exigindo o módulo ‘ActiveSupport :: CoreExtensions :: String :: Inflections’, por exemplo:

require 'active_support/core_ext/string/inflections'

'FooNamespace::FooBar'.demodulize
> 'FooBar'